diff options
Diffstat (limited to 'src/tools/qdoc/cppcodeparser.h')
| -rw-r--r-- | src/tools/qdoc/cppcodeparser.h | 25 |
1 files changed, 15 insertions, 10 deletions
diff --git a/src/tools/qdoc/cppcodeparser.h b/src/tools/qdoc/cppcodeparser.h index 7499575d13d..f7a46b093ac 100644 --- a/src/tools/qdoc/cppcodeparser.h +++ b/src/tools/qdoc/cppcodeparser.h @@ -65,15 +65,15 @@ public: CppCodeParser(); ~CppCodeParser(); - virtual void initializeParser(const Config& config); - virtual void terminateParser(); - virtual QString language(); - virtual QStringList headerFileNameFilter(); - virtual QStringList sourceFileNameFilter(); - virtual void parseHeaderFile(const Location& location, const QString& filePath); - virtual void parseSourceFile(const Location& location, const QString& filePath); - virtual void doneParsingHeaderFiles(); - virtual void doneParsingSourceFiles(); + virtual void initializeParser(const Config& config) Q_DECL_OVERRIDE; + virtual void terminateParser() Q_DECL_OVERRIDE; + virtual QString language() Q_DECL_OVERRIDE; + virtual QStringList headerFileNameFilter() Q_DECL_OVERRIDE; + virtual QStringList sourceFileNameFilter() Q_DECL_OVERRIDE; + virtual void parseHeaderFile(const Location& location, const QString& filePath) Q_DECL_OVERRIDE; + virtual void parseSourceFile(const Location& location, const QString& filePath) Q_DECL_OVERRIDE; + virtual void doneParsingHeaderFiles() Q_DECL_OVERRIDE; + virtual void doneParsingSourceFiles() Q_DECL_OVERRIDE; protected: const QSet<QString>& topicCommands(); @@ -156,7 +156,7 @@ protected: int tok; Node::Access access; FunctionNode::Metaness metaness; - QString moduleName; + QString physicalModuleName; QStringList lastPath_; QRegExp varComment; QRegExp sep; @@ -234,6 +234,11 @@ protected: #define COMMAND_LICENSEDESCRIPTION Doc::alias("licensedescription") #define COMMAND_RELEASEDATE Doc::alias("releasedate") #define COMMAND_QTVARIABLE Doc::alias("qtvariable") +#define COMMAND_JSTYPE Doc::alias("jstype") +#define COMMAND_JSPROPERTY Doc::alias("jsproperty") +#define COMMAND_JSMETHOD Doc::alias("jsmethod") +#define COMMAND_JSSIGNAL Doc::alias("jssignal") +#define COMMAND_JSMODULE Doc::alias("jsmodule") QT_END_NAMESPACE |
